There are several call sites that call extent_clear_unlock_delalloc() with locked_page and PAGE_CLEAR_DIRTY/PAGE_SET_WRITEBACK/PAGE_END_WRITEBACK - cow_file_range() - run_delalloc_nocow() - cow_file_range_async() All for their error handling branches. For those call sites, since we skip the locked page for dirty/error/writeback bit update, the locked page will still have its subpage dirty bit remaining. Normally it's the call sites which locked the page to handle the locked page, but it won't hurt if we also do the update. Especially there are already other call sites doing the same thing by manually passing NULL as locked_page.
